## What happens

Lucas Trask and Elaine are married in a grand ceremony presided over by Duke Angus of Wardshaven, who uses royal language hinting at his ambitions. The celebration is shattered when Andray Dunnan ambushes the couple with a submachine gun, wounding Lucas and ending the joyous occasion in violence.

## Themes in this chapter

### Class and Social Mobility

The wedding is a political alliance between noble houses, with the marriage agreement meticulously detailing rights and inheritance to avoid future conflict.

### Revenge and Justice

Dunnan's assassination attempt on Trask is a violent act of revenge, likely tied to Trask's earlier pursuit of justice against him.

### Political Systems and Governance

Duke Angus's use of royal language and the crowd's acclamation reveal the fragile political order, where a duke's ambition to become king could trigger mercenary wars.

## Character check-ins

### Lucas Trask

The groom, Baron of Traskon, who is shot by Dunnan immediately after the wedding ceremony.

### Elaine

The bride, daughter of Sesar Karvall, who is tripped by Lucas as Dunnan opens fire.

### Angus of Gram

Duke of Wardshaven who officiates the wedding, using royal language that signals his ambition to become king.

### Sesar Karvall

Father of the bride, Baron of Karvall mills, who escorts Elaine to the ceremony.

### Nikkolay Trask

Cousin of Lucas, who announces Lucas at the wedding and helps coordinate the event.

### Andray Dunnan

The assassin who ambushes the wedding party, firing a submachine gun at Lucas and Elaine.
